2008-09-30 4 views
0

Мне нужно переместить данные из datareader в компонент Farpoint Spreadsheet в форме Windows. DataSource листа fps can't be set to a datareader. Я не хочу менять свое приложение, чтобы использовать ADO только для этой цели.Лучший способ получить данные из DataReader в электронную таблицу Farpoint?

Прямо сейчас я просматриваю данные запроса и вставляю его в ячейку по ячейке. Это уродливо, и я уверен, что производительность будет страдать для больших наборов данных (хотя я еще не пробовал это).

Кто-нибудь здесь знает, как лучше получить datareader в один из этих компонентов? Я использую VB.NET, но пример C# будет в порядке.

ответ

2

Я не знаком с продуктом, но вы можете попробовать загрузить читателя в DataTable и привязать его, если он поддерживается.

Dim dt as Datatable 
dt.load(reader) 
+0

Это звучит неплохо. Я попробую сегодня вечером, когда снова посмотрю код. – JosephStyons 2008-09-30 12:46:12

Смежные вопросы